Product details

  • Actors: Walter Matthau, Ossie Davis, Amy Irving, Craig T. Nelson, Boyd Gaines
  • Directors: Herb Gardner
  • Writers: Herb Gardner
  • Producers: David Sameth, John H. Starke, John Penotti
  • Format: Colour, DVD-Video, NTSC
  • Language English
  • Region: Region 1 (US and Canada DVD formats.)
  • Aspect Ratio: 16:9 - 1.85:1
  • Number of discs: 1
  • Classification: PG-13 (Parental Guidance Suggested) (US MPAA rating. See details.)
  • Studio: Universal Studios
  • DVD Release Date: 3 Aug 2004
  • Run Time: 135 minutes

Absolutely brilliant! 10 Oct 2009
By Diana TOP 1000 REVIEWER
Format:DVD
Walter Matthau is Rappaport-a nice old fellow that walks through Central Park, observes other people and makes friends amongst the ones he meets in the park.He just wants to be left alone, he has children but only one of them-a girl is concerned about her father.This is a wonderful movie about the relationships that develop between people, the father-children relation-he is so grateful to be left alone and the experience of getting old.
Matthau shines in this picture, a bitter-sweet comedy about the world seen through an old man's eyes who is young and lively in his heart.
Wonderful, heart warming movie, well worth having it in your personal movie collection!

Want a good belly-laugh? This one's for you.... 23 Feb 1999
By A Customer - Published on Amazon.com
We couldn't stop laughing! Two old codgers sitting on a park bench getting stoned...laughs are sure to follow. Tackles some big issues, too, although true to life, no big solutions are found. Aging, the homeless, drugs, violence. All this and more can be seen through the witty eyes of Walter Matheau and Ossie Davis. I'm buying this video so that I can watch it again and again!
